Original artwork description:

This pencil drawing is a study of a friend who posed for me. The only advice given was to 'think of something that affected you deeply'. I didn't want to know the nature of the event, I only wanted to record the effect through a portrait capturing her thoughts. This image was part of a series of pencils works exploring a wide range of subjects, some of which no longer exist except as photographs now.

The idea behind the work was to capture the psychological through a drawing, exploring how people are affected physically by something mentally,

Materials used:

Pencil/ Graphite on Cartiridge Paper
